Subject: adonis with blocking (not nesting)

Dear R for ecology experts,
I have found many discussions online about blocking and nesting in adonis, but no answers for blocking.  I have community data with abundances within 42 aquatic genera (final.fd[,9:36]) from 2 types of streams (type).  Stream samples were paired (pair) as a blocking factor.  So the individual samples (n=12; I know, permuations will be limited) are one of two types and blocked within pairs.  I am using strata to restrict permuations within the blocking factor. However, I haven't found a way to specify the blocking in the data structure.
   If I use paired=T, how do I specify the pairing variable?  
adonis(final.fd[,9:42] ~ final.fd$type, paired=T, method = "bray", strata=final.fd$pair)
   If there is another way to set the blocking factor, what is it?
